Title :
A broadband manpack antenna for SINCGARS range extension

Abstract :
A broadband manpack antenna that extends the range of a frequency hopping SINCGARS radio by a factor of three has been developed. A single integral broadband matching network covers the entire 30 to 88 MHz band. Rather than designing to maximize the low point of the gain distribution, the antenna was optimized for minimum bit error rate with a full-band frequency hopping set. This antenna will be used for certain specific applications that allow fielding a long antenna. The VSWR (voltage standing wave ratio) is compatible with the SINCGARS radio, and the gain over frequency provides significant range extension in single channel as well as frequency hopping mode
